Fatigue is a universal complaint that occurs with everyday life. It is often the first indication of the occurrence of some abnormality. The protective body mechanism warns that the body's physiological equilibrium is being broken down somewhere. Fatigue must not be understood as an indication of breakdown, but rather as an index of stress on adaptive body mechanism. Fatigue, therefore, must be considered as one of important concepts in health maintenace, and accordingly, a conceptual analysis is explored in this study. A precise understanding of fatigue will facilitate pinpointing causes and measuring outcomes, as well as understanding of overall phenomena. The study will contribute to building unambiguous communication among practitioners. From the process of conceptual analysis, fatigue can be defined as: 1. The meaning of fatigue encompasses causes involved, status(disturbance in homeostasis) and results thereof as well as feelings outcome. 2. Fatigue is composed of a series of feedback loop 3. Fatigue induces shortage in capacity (physically, psychologically, and / or emotionally) 4. Fatigue is a subjective self-evaluated sensation 5. Fatigue is a signal of disturbance in homeostasis 6. Fatigue varies in causes 7. Fatigue varies in its status
